Exploring is a hands-on program that gives high school students (ages 14-17) real-world experience in career fields. We’re excited to offer our newest Explorer post with Hawaiian Airlines.
The 12-week program will take place on Tuesdays from 5:30 to 8:30 PM from late February to early May, 2017.
Students will:
- Participate in hands-on learning experiences in maintenance, cargo, business, pilot, air traffic control, and more.
- Develop career skills including interviewing, leadership, presentation, and teamwork skills.
- Learn about educational and occupational requirements to achieve a successful career in aviation.
